Our Annual Spring Trip this school year will be to Myrtle Beach, SC for the purpose of participating in the the FiestaVal Competition being held there. Since these are group performances, all Guitar II-III and Ensemble students are expected to attend. Receiving the professional musical adjudication is the primary purpose of this trip. However, as time and planning allow, the group may attend one of the following: an IMAX show, the Myrtle Beach Aquarium, or the Alligator Farm, and the awards ceremony will be held at the Hard Rock Amusement Park. We will be staying in condos -- groups of 5 to 6 per condo unit. The exact itinerary and final total cost are subject to change.
Opportunities for the students to raise funds toward their trip will be available throughout the year beginning with the current Fruit/Cheese/ Sausage Fundraiser that runs from October 30 to November 13th. The Guitar Boosters do not front the cost of the trip. All monies are forwarded to the tour company on a planned schedule, therefore all payments by participants must be made on time and are non-refundable. TRIP RULES AND REGULATIONS
- All Fairfax County Public School rules and regulations apply. At the beginning of the year all FCPS students and parents signed the FCPS Participation Policy for Extracurricular Activities and Athletic Programs. This document may be reviewed on our web site at www.westfieldguitar.org in the Forms section. Illegal substances, alcohol, and any tobacco products are strictly forbidden and chaperones will be instructed to bring any proven substance to the immediate attention of the Guitar Director for disciplinary action. There is a zero tolerance policy and the offender may be sent home (via airplane) at the expense of the student’s family.
- No student is permitted to bring beverage cans or bottles (including water) on this trip. WHS Guitar Boosters will provide water along the way. Students will be able to purchase drinks during rest breaks and bring them aboard the bus.
- Civilized behavior is expected! Students should dress, act, and speak like mature ladies and gentlemen. You represent Westfield High School Music Department, Fairfax County, VA, your parents, and most importantly, yourself and all teenagers. Be courteous, considerate and respectful of chaperones, other students and people you might meet.
- Common sense should be used including dress, public displays of affection (this includes on the bus), language and other behavior. Respect for all is the key!
- Chaperones are the eyes and ears of the director. Do not argue with chaperones about any situation! They join us because they enjoy being around young adults and enjoy the musical talents of everyone! Making this a pleasant experience for the chaperones will make it a pleasant one for you the guitar students, too.
- Promptness is important! When you are given a time and place to meet, be on time! Be where you need to be, when you need to be there and BE PREPARED.
- All medications must be registered upon departure. They will be held by chaperones on the bus.
-
Due to noise levels and safety issues, boom boxes, water guns, skateboards or roller blades are not permitted. Any other items deemed a safety risk may be confiscated and held for the duration of the trip.
-
Hotel boundaries and site rules will be established when we arrive. You must be within these boundaries, travel in groups of at least 3 at all times (at least one member of the group must carry a cell phone that the chaperones have the number for), and chaperones must be informed of your whereabouts at all times. At certain times, you MAY be instructed to stay within site of a chaperone.
-
Appropriate disciplinary measures will be instituted at the discretion of the guitar director, which may include restriction from participating in group activities, or immediate return home at the expense of the parent/guardian without recourse or reimbursement for missed activities. Further disciplinary action may be undertaken by Westfield High School Administrators.
